DESCRIPTION:SAND QUEEN is a startling, moving, riveting and disturbing story that 
 unfolds in and around a U.S. military prison in the desert in Iraq. It is 
 told from the points of view of two women: one a  U.S. soldier and the 
 other an Iraqi medical student.\n\nThe novel is based on Benedict’s 
 research for her most recent nonfiction book, THE LONELY SOLDIER: THE 
 PRIVATE WAR OF WOMEN SERVING IN IRAQ which has won several awards, 
 including the EMMA (Exception Merit in Media Award) from the National 
 Women's Political Caucus and the Ken Book Award, both in 2010.\n\nBenedict 
 has testified twice to Congress on behalf of women soldiers, and lectures 
 at colleges and military academies around the country about gender justice 
 and the military. Her book and play about women soldiers inspired the the 
 February 2011 class action suit against the Pentagon and Secretaries of 
 Defense Rumsfeld and Gates on behalf of military women who have been 
 sexually harassed or assaulted while serving.\n\nA play Benedict wrote 
 based on her interviews with women soldiers, THE LONELY SOLDIER MONOLOGUES, 
 was produced in 2009 and 2010 at two New York City Theaters, The Theater 
 for the New City and La Mama Experimental Theatre Club, and is currently 
 being performed at several campus theaters around the country. The play is 
 available for further productions. See Helen Benedict's website to find out
